Chrysler is still a brand that has a certain reverence in the American automotive market. The 2015 Chrysler 200 is the luxury midsize sedan offering from the brand and has a reputation for offering good equipment and plush materials. However, its reputation in terms of reliability is terrible as it has reported 1818 complaints and has issued 8 recalls this year alone. Some of these complaints have been quite serious including suspension failures, engine failures, transmission failures, and so on. With prices starting at an MSRP of $22,990, it is in a category with competition like the Toyota Camry, the Ford Fusion, and the Honda Accord. 2015 Chrysler 200 User Complaints and Problems
Mechanical problems:
- The brake system of this car is known to produce loud squealing sounds and can often fail to respond to driver input. Brake booster problems are quite common and the car may not be able to be controlled in the event of a booster failure.
- The engines used in this car are prone to have oil leaks. Even without the presence of leaks, some cars have reported excessive oil consumption.
- The starter motor is another common problem area and is known to fail in many cars. Issues with the Chrysler 200 not starting are extremely common.
- The electronic power steering used in this particular vehicle has suffered from multiple issues including falls with the steering angle sensors. It can also provide intermittent lack of assistance and feel completely in several cases.
- The engine also has problems associated with stalling and has to be warmed up sufficiently to avoid this scenario. Even after this, several cars have been stranded on the road. Despite all of this, the brand has not issued a Chrysler 200 engine recall.
- The throttle control module in this car is one of the causes of the engine stalling.
- Both the engine and transmission mounts are susceptible to failure and this can cause excessive jerkiness.These are classified under Chrysler 200 gear shift problems.
- The suspension of this system has failed in many cars and will result in the car going completely out of control.
Electrical system problems:
- The key fob is ineffective in many cases because the car fails to recognize it. In this event, the car has to be locked and unlocked manually.
- This car is fitted with an active grille shutter which has to open to allow engine cooling. This can often fail and result in catastrophic engine failure.
- The transmission system is a known area for malfunctions as it can switch back to neutral when trying to shift to Park. In fact, issues with the transmission are very common in this car and are widely reported.
- Several 2015 Chrysler 200 electrical problems are present including the HVAC, radio, backup camera, and Bluetooth functions not properly functioning.
- The airbag warning light was illuminated in several cars and may have problems with the function.
- The electrical system is prone to complete failure and the car can shut itself down when driving. This will lead the owners to panic and not know what to do.
- The gear shift is also prone to malfunction and can select the wrong gear or indicate that the car is in a different year.
- A lot of cars have also had issues in which they went up completely in flames due to electrical faults.
- The AC blower motor is another known area of failure and shuts off in many cars. This can result in air conditioner failure and is an expensive repair.
- The headlights are another known problem area as they can fail to illuminate properly, causing a complete lack of vision at night.
- The electronic stability control is prone to failure and could be quite dangerous because it can mean the car goes out of control.
- The electronic parking brake warning has been issued for many cars and this would prevent the car from stopping safely.
Interior problems:
- Due to an issue identified with the tempered glass, the sunroof of this car is prone to shattering. This can send sharp fragments of glass inside the cabin and cause further issues.
Exterior problems:
- There are multiple issues with quality control including the doors not being able to be closed properly. The panel gaps are not uniform as one would expect from a car of this price
- The rims of the car have several faults like lug bolts loosening themselves and causing damage to the rim and other catastrophic failures.
Safety problems
- The wiring harness for the airbag and as well as the airbag module seem to be faulty. This will result in airbag warning lights illuminated in several cars.
- There have been a lot of incidents in which Chrysler 200s were involved in near-fatal collisions and none of the airbags were deployed.
- The seatbelt indicator has also produced a lot of problems for owners. It does not detect the presence of passengers correctly. The issue is with the occupant detection system.
2015 Chrysler 200 Recalls
S. No. |
Date |
NHTSA Campaign Number |
Issues Noticed |
Additional Remarks |
Remedy |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
1 |
May 17, 2018 |
18V332000 |
Cruise control cannot be canceled |
The cruise control has a defect and will not disengage and will cause a collision. |
Dealers will perform a software flash |
2 |
July 12, 2016 |
16V529000 |
Transmission can unexpectedly shift to neutral |
The transmission sensor clusters may have insufficient crimps |
Dealers will reprogram the powertrain control module and transmission control module and replace the transaxle range sensor wiring harness if necessary |
3 |
February 26, 2016 |
16V114000 |
Airbag may deploy improperly |
The occupant classification module or seat cushion foam may have been replaced separately, which can create an incorrectly calibrated set |
Dealers will install a new OCM-SCF seat service kit |
4 |
July 28, 2015 |
15V470000 |
Intermittent connection C-4 connector and PDC |
The power distribution center electrical connector may cause intermittent power failures to electrical components |
Dealers will replace the C-4 connector using a 12-wire split kit or replace the transmission wiring harness |
5 |
July 23, 2015 |
15V461000 |
Radio software security vulnerabilities |
The radio software may have security vulnerabilities that can allow third-party access to certain networked vehicle control systems |
Chrysler will mail a USB drive that includes a software update that can rule out the problems |
6 |
February 13, 2015 |
15V090000 |
Automatic transmission may not be able to shift to Park |
Automatic transmission parking pawl may become contaminated |
Dealers will inspect the transmission and replace the parts if necessary |
7 |
August 5, 2014 |
14V480000 |
Driver door wiring harness may have insufficient gauge |
Excessive heat can melt the driver side door wiring harness |
Dealers will replace the driver side door wiring harness |
8 |
July 2, 2014 |
14V392000 |
Rear shock absorbers may partially detach |
Due to insufficient welds, there the rear shock absorber may detach from the vehicle |
Dealers will inspect the rear shocks and replace any affected ones |
